{"data":{"id":"us-ut/utah-code-70a-9a-327","jurisdiction":"us-ut","citation":"Utah Code § 70A-9a-327","heading":"Priority of security interests in deposit account.","body":"The following rules govern priority among conflicting security interests in the same deposit account:\n(1) A security interest held by a secured party having control of the deposit account under Section 70A-9a-104 has priority over a conflicting security interest held by a secured party that does not have control.\n(2) Except as otherwise provided in Subsections (3) and (4), security interests perfected by control under Section 70A-9a-314 rank according to priority in time of obtaining control.\n(3) Except as otherwise provided in Subsection (4), a security interest held by the bank with which the deposit account is maintained has priority over a conflicting security interest held by another secured party.\n(4) A security interest perfected by control under Subsection 70A-9a-104(1)(c) has priority over a security interest held by the bank with which the deposit account is maintained.","path":["Title 70A Uniform Commercial Code","Chapter 70A-9a Uniform Commercial Code - Secured Transactions","Part 70A-9a-3 Perfection and Priority"],"source_url":"https://le.utah.gov/xcode/Title70A/Chapter9a/70A-9a-S327.html","current_through":"2026 General Session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-03T11:34:34Z","sha256":"909ee33374c87ab9550e5dc6807a0cd3396ad9af06aa9d9ec746f7da7ea6baf8","source_id":"us-ut","stale":false,"prev":"us-ut/utah-code-70a-9a-326.1","next":"us-ut/utah-code-70a-9a-328"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
